About 7 Elder Close
7 Elder Close is a mid-terrace house in Sawston, Cambridge, Cambridge (CB22 3BB).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2022) shows a C (score 72). The rating has held steady at C across 3 certificates since December 2011.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 112), a 2-band jump.
Untraded for 27 years, with the last transfer in February 1999.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£323,000 sits 311.5% above the 1999 sale of £78,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£101/sq ft) was about 47.7% below the postcode norm.
